Hornets Finish First in Terrapin Invite; Women Come in Third
 
LANDOVER, Md.—The Delaware State men finished in first place overall with a team score of 119.5 points at the Terrapin Invitational on Saturday afternoon, while the Lady Hornets placed third with 76.5 points on the day.

Morgan State Men’s Track Concludes Competition at Gamecocks Opener
 
COLUMBIA, S.C.--The Morgan State men's track & field team had nine top-10 finishes and earned one podium finish at the Gamecock Opener this past weekend. Junior Kobe-Jordan Rhooms took home second-place honors in the men's long jump with a leap of 7.02 meters (23'0.5") and also placed sixth in the high jump with a mark of 1.98 meters (6'6") along with sophomore teammate Lamar Davis.
